在Linux系统中,write
操作本身并不直接对文件系统的安全性构成威胁。然而,其安全性取决于多个因素,包括操作的环境、执行的上下文以及系统的整体安全设置。
首先,write
操作用于将数据写入文件或设备。在正常的系统使用中,这是一个基本且必要的功能。但是,如果write
操作被恶意地执行,例如通过缓冲区溢出攻击或权限过高的用户访问,那么它可能会导致数据损坏、系统崩溃或其他安全问题。
为了提高write
操作的安全性,可以采取以下措施:
- 最小权限原则:确保只有经过身份验证和授权的用户才能执行
write
操作。这可以通过使用用户和组权限、访问控制列表(ACL)或其他安全机制来实现。 - 输入验证和过滤:在允许
write
操作之前,对输入数据进行严格的验证和过滤,以防止恶意代码或数据被注入到系统中。 - 使用安全的编程实践:在编写使用
write
操作的程序时,遵循安全的编程实践,例如避免缓冲区溢出、使用安全的字符串处理函数等。 - 审计和监控:定期审计和监控系统中的
write
操作,以检测任何异常或可疑的行为。这可以帮助及时发现并响应潜在的安全威胁。
总之,虽然write
操作本身并不直接对Linux系统的安全性构成威胁,但其安全性取决于多个因素。通过采取适当的安全措施,可以降低write
操作被恶意利用的风险。